Ryan Fugger, a Vancouver Web developer, was the first to implement Ripple cryptocurrency. Fugger developed a system called Ripplepay in 2005 that provided a secure payment solution for the online community. The Ripplepay protocol was the basis of the Ripplepay system. In 2011, Ripple issued its own crypto currency called XRP. Jed McCaleb. Arthur Britto. and David Schwartz are the founders of Ripple. Their aim was to create an alternative to centralized exchanges. Ripple also explains that its technology uses much less electricity than Bitcoin, and transactions take a fraction of the time.

Although the first blockchains were intended to record Bitcoin transactions, today many other cryptocurrencies are available, including Ethereum, Ripple and Dogecoin. Mining is required in order to secure these blockchains and put new coins in circulation.
Proof-of work is the process of mining. This method allows miners to compete against one another to solve cryptographic puzzles. Miners who find the solution are rewarded by newlyminted coins.
